Steps to Hiring your First Employee in Utah Step 1 – Register as an Employer. Step 2 – Employee Eligibility Verification. Step 3 – Employee Withholding Allowance Certificate. Step 4 – New Hire Reporting.

Form I-9. The Form I-9 verifies a new employee's identity and their eligibility to work in the United States. It has an employee and employer section, with employees required to complete their portion by the first day of their employment.

New employee forms are documents an onboarding employee completes for a company. Some forms are required by law, such as tax forms, while others may be for a particular company or position. They help verify the new employee understands company policies, compensation payments and benefits.
